
Synopsis/Details
A group of NASA scientists are dispatched to secure the scene of a meteor crash in Southern California, only to discover that the area's wildlife has been turned in bloodthirsty undead monsters. With the aid of a local Marine squad, they must race against time to find a way to stop the apocalypse before it's too late, all while being pursued by a ruthless vigilante who has been hired by the Deputy Director of the Ames Research Facility, who has his own agenda.
